About Sunnmøre Alps Landscape Protection Area

Sunnmøre Alps Landscape Protection Area
 

The Sunnmøre Alps Landscape Protection Area stretches across the southern part of Møre og Romsdal county, encompassing some of Norway's most spectacular mountain scenery. Characterized by sharp granite peaks that rise abruptly from fjords and valleys, the region provides a rugged backdrop for outdoor adventures. The area draws mountaineers and skiers due to its combination of challenging terrain, extensive glaciers, and reliable snow cover in winter. The landscape is carved by ancient glaciers and marked by deep fjords such as the Hjørundfjord and Storfjord, creating striking contrasts of alpine peaks set against water. Ecologically, the area includes alpine tundra, wetland meadows, and small pockets of mountain birch forest, supporting diverse bird species and mountain fauna. Historically, the region has been sparsely populated with traditional farming and fishing communities along the fjords. Modern tourism infrastructure supports activities like guided climbing, backcountry skiing, and multi-day hiking trips with access to mountain cabins operated by the Norwegian Trekking Association (DNT). Popular climbing routes like the Segla and Slogen peaks offer spectacular panoramas of the fjords below. Visitors are drawn to the area's combination of untouched scenery and challenging outdoor opportunities. Protection measures emphasize maintaining the pristine landscape and limiting development to safeguard the fragile alpine environment.

Notable Natural Features

Segla

A dramatic sheer cliff rising sharply from the fjord, popular for climbers and hikers seeking breathtaking views.

Slogen

A distinctive pyramid-shaped peak offering challenging hikes and grand panoramas over the fjord landscape.

Hjørundfjord

A narrow, deep fjord flanked by the alpine mountains, prized for kayaking and boat excursions.
